Fetal morbidity occurs secondary to the limited ability of the fetal liver to remove bile acids from the blood and the vasoconstricting effect of bile acids on human placental chorionic veins. Obstetric cholestasis is a multifactorial condition of pregnancy characterised by pruritus in the absence of a skin rash with abnormal liver function tests (LFTs), neither of which has an alternative cause and both of which resolve after birth. Cholestasis is defined as a decrease in bile flow due to impaired secretion by hepatocytes or to obstruction of bile flow through intra-or extrahepatic bile ducts. For hepatocellular cholestasis, which would be considered a form of intra-hepatic cholestasis since it’s happening inside the liver, a really important culprit is the hormone estrogen. Estrogen is thought to basically cause the hepatocytes to not be able to pump out bile acids, usually in the form of cholic acid, which is produced when hepatocytes break down cholesterol.
